It sounds like such a simple thing but portable air conditioning units really can save lives. Many buildings become extremely hot especially on the upper levels during the summer months. The heat in these upper units can become excruciating especially on hot summer days when the temperature in these upper level rooms can hit up around one hundred and thirty degrees or more. Structures with black tar roofs and those with tin roofs are particularly prone to excruciatingly high temperatures and these temperatures can be deadly.
There are many regions of the country that require units to provide either portable air conditioning units or central air to their residents. Unfortunately, there are many people who are living in poorer regions who can not afford to pay for air conditioning and these individuals are potentially at risk of death.
Especially susceptible to illness and death are the elderly, the sick, infants and children and many of these people can be helped by purchasing portable units especially in upper level units. Even just one small window unit can be enough to cool the temperatures in these hot boxes making them more tolerable dwellings to live in and creating a safer environment for all family members.
Unfortunately, many individuals don't realize how inexpensive and affordable portable air units truly are. A small window unit can be purchased at a local hardware store for under $100. In most cases those who are renting an apartment or town home may be able to get the housing unit to pay part or all of the cost. Units can even be purchased through online sales, yard sales and through local classified ads. Even when purchasing a used unit as long as it works and it is tested prior to being purchased it can still be quite effective in cooling down the excessive heat in an upstairs unit.
In any situation with older or younger family members, it is imperative to consider and make sure that there is a thermostat in place. While an air conditioner is the most effective way to cool off a living space the temperature should be constantly monitored to ensure the safety of all the occupants. It will take much less heat to overwhelm an infant, young child or elderly family member and allowing them to spend too much time in the excessive heat can cause them to suffer from heat stroke and die. Temperatures in excess of 100 degrees Fahrenheit can be deadly and can cause heat stroke in death within a matter of minutes.
